question about training frequency

I like most of you enjoy going to the gym. I love lifting and that becomes a double edged sword and make me suseptable to over training. Currently I do 1 body part per day to total failure.
Mon Chest/Cardio
Tues Back
Wed Shoulders/Cardio
Thurs Arms (tri's first then bi's)
Fri Cardio
Sat off
Sun Legs

I mix things up as far as exercises go and focus on compound movements but I am stuck at a plateau. Diet is dialed and clean. Am I in your opinion over training? Should I be taking more rest days? And last, if I were to combine some body parts would I be ok doing cardio on my off days or do I need those as "rest" days. Thanks

1)The bad things I can spot by glancing at your routine, is that you pile up your large muscle groups together in 3 days in a row, which might interfere with optimal rest/recovery, therefor deteriorating possible better performance as well as hindering gains.

2)You put cardio and off days together as well, since cardio is just like an off day, I would insert the cardio day somewhere else.


Maybe :

Arms
Back
Shoulders
Off
Legs
Chest
Cardio
